Explore Balik Pulau
Join this small-group cycling tour to explore the countryside of Penang, Balik Pulau. The tour will start at 7am from your hotel where we will transfer you to Balik Pulau. Exploring the town by bicycle has all the advantages of going by foot, combined with a much greater action radius and cooling breeze. If you want to experience Balik Pulau hideaways and countryside, touched by the charm of Malaysian way of country life at personal level, bicycle is a great way to do it. This tour will bring you to see local life in the Penang countryside. Away from Balik Pulau town there is a labyrinth of minor roads, pathways and alleys. Cyclists are treated as pedestrians, so you can use bicycle to explore fruit orchard, plantation, mangrove, fishing village and dozens of traditional Kampung in Penang.
